"Yeah, you really shouldn´t wander the underdark by yourself, even when as skilled with blades as you obviously are."Vierna smiles grimly at Rinnill "I´m Vierna, our guide you might say, and we are travelling to Neverlight grove for now, even though some of us will probably look for a way to the surface eventually." While talking Vierna calmly collects an arrow that has pierced the rubbery skin of the abomination. "There´s quite a few of us now, but you are welcome to join us if ou like."
Runnill looks around at the motley group, clearly sizing them up. Once his eyes spy the symbol on Venrila‘s shield, his eyes light up. “You are a follower of Eilistraee?” When she says she is, the new drow smiles. “I was worried I had encountered servants of Lolth.” He looks around again. “I am looking for my father and brother.” He gives a quick description of each. “I’m not sure how long they’ve been down here under the surface, so I don’t know where to look.”
"Haven´t seen them I´m afraid, but you don´t run into many people in the underdark, these travellers being a rare exception." Vierna gestures at the group behind her in the cavern. "And you will find no servants of that vile spider goddess among us, of that you can be sure, although I think that one was recently reformed."Smiling grimly and nodding in the direction of Asha. "Since you don´t know where to look you might as well join us, the settlements in the underdark are few and far between, but our path will probably take us by the duergar city of Gracklstugh. Perhaps you want to start your search there. I didn´t catch your name there though bladesinger."
"Ah!" Rinnill says, looking both surprised and a bit abashed. "Rinnill Teloara," he says, smiling brightly. "You must know many bladesingers to have found me out so quickly. As for joining you, that sounds much better than searching on my own. I've grown up hearing many tales about the Underdark, but this is my first journey, and I'd have to say the tales are not nearly as dangerous as the actual place." He absently rubs his neck near a large welt.
"Well met Rinnill Teloara. I know of your kind and made an educated guess.The humming and the fancy footwork gave it away a bit I think." Smiling back at Rinnill. "So you too are from the surface then. You will find yourself in good company here even though I myself spent most of my lifetime wandering these caves and tunnels. I thought about visiting the surface but I don´t understand how you can live with that blistering light from above." A brief pause. " Oh, did the abomination harm you Rinnill?"
"Bladesinger..." Xunhar mutters and dwells on the thought for a moment, then snaps out of it "We should move. The sounds of battle may have come to the attention of others."
"Yes I agree Xunhar, let´s move out." Vierna grabs her backpack from the cave and prepares to scout ahead, aiming for the best route to the Darklake where there will be decided if we try to cross it by raft or go around it.
